**Onboarding: CatalogueBridge Import Access**

External plugin authors integrating with CatalogueBridge, our library catalogue import pipeline, receive a sandboxed import slot. Your plugin submits MARC-style records, which the pipeline validates and stages overnight. Sandbox credentials expire every 30 days; when yours lapse mid-development, you can restore the slot yourself rather than waiting for support. To do so, supply the recovery passphrase listed below.

unlock words, fahop-yageg: ralwyn-kelath

## Changelog — Garagelink Occupancy Feed v3.2

Renamed `FEED_TOKEN` to `GARAGELINK_FEED_SECRET` to match our naming convention; the old name is no longer read. Support: when customers report an empty occupancy feed after upgrading, check their env file first. The corrected entry should appear exactly as on the following line.

sealed setting: ARCHIVE_KEY3=8d0

# Artifact Signing — Quenchmill Compaction Module

This page documents signing requirements for the Quenchmill log-compaction plugin, which rewrites queue segments in place. Because compaction has destructive potential, every build is signed and verified twice: at promotion and at load time by the broker. Verification failures halt the compactor and page the on-call. Reviewers should confirm the chain terminates at the key published below.

rollout seal: bky4_DFM9